Which are the better weapons

Postby Lucus009 at 24 Mar 2008, 03:13

The Bright Lance or pulse laser?
With the bight lance you Shot 36in 8S AP:1 and makes armor value higher than 12, 12(with 1 shot)
On the other hand the Pulse laser shots twice at 48in, but doesn’t get rid of armor.
I think the pulse laser is the better deal because it comes with the falcon while you have to by the Lance. What do you think?

Re: Which are the better weapons

Postby IBBoard at 24 Mar 2008, 11:13

Depends what you're facing.

On the hole the pulse laser would probably be my choice as most tanks I've seen go up to armour 12 (a Predator is possibly 13 on the front, but that's when the Falcon just uses its speed to get to the side armour). Also, giving my ability at rolling dice then the more dice I have the more likely I am to actually do something! That's part of the reason I like Orks ;)

On the other hand, if I was facing a Land Raider then I think the Bright Lance may be more useful, even if I do only have a single dice roll. I was going to mention the Monolith as well, but doesn't it have the "Living Metal" rule that stops things like the Bright Lance decreasing its armour?
